CREST SPRING RR, UGLEY, ESSEX, 110km - SUNDAY 7TH MARCH 2004

Phil Moon, Frank Rawlins, George Olive and Tony Bradford raced in their opening road race of the season, the Crest Spring RR.  The weather was far from spring like with wet roads, sleet and a chill wind blowing from the north.  The race was a 70 mile marathon in North West Essex taking in the Littlebury climb 8 times.  Tony was first out the back with a puncture 35 miles into the race.  George and Frank lost contact on the fourth climb as the pace hotted up and the weather worsened. The weather, climb and punctures whittled the pack down to less than half and there were several small groups on the road as the race drew to a close.  Phil Moon, returning to racing after over a decade, hung on in to the bitter end to finish in 17th place.  The Winner, Ed Whitehorn of the Glendene showed the pack a clean pair of heels in the final laps throwing down the gauntlet early in the Essex Road Race League.
